Some of you might know that May is Mental Health Awareness Month. Throughout the entire month its encouraged to highlight and recognize the importance of mental health advocates, prevention organizations, and community members who educate, bring awareness and share resources to help individuals and families affected by mental health issues.
 
On May 5th, 2024 I had the pleasure and honor of preforming with SHAMAN, a band created by Steven Dee Harris at The Music Heals the Heart Fundraiser in Westbury, NY. This fundraiser is hosted every year in memory of Eric. C. Doll.
All proceeds are donated to the Long Island American Foundation for Suicide Prevention, the Cope Foundation & the Eric C. Doll Calhoun High School Memorial Scholarship.
